Identifying Dashwood Sisters in Sense and Sensibility

This question requires identifying the main Dashwood sisters from Jane Austen's novel Sense and Sensibility.

Key Characters

  • Elinor Dashwood: The elder and more reserved sister.
  • Marianne Dashwood: The younger, more passionate, and romantic sister.
  • Mary and Amanda: These names do not correspond to the Dashwood sisters in the novel.

Correct Combination

Based on the novel, the principal Dashwood sisters are Elinor and Marianne.

Therefore, the correct combination is I and II.
